Missing door lock "faceplate" part

A home owner from Los Angeles says:
I am not sure of the name of this part. But the piece that the door hooks cling onto in order to lock the door is missing from one of my sliding doors. The first picture shows what the piece looks like on a different door. Any help to buy a replacement would be greatly appreciated!

Lauren from SWISCO responded:

Hello, thank you for posting,

The strike plate in the first picture resembles the 89-042 along with the 89-043 cover. If the other door uses the same lock style, please review the dimensions of this strike plate to determine a good fit! Let us know if you have any additional questions!
